Skip to content
This repository has been archived by the owner on Sep 3, 2024. It is now read-only.

Commit

Permalink
IE11 support
Browse files Browse the repository at this point in the history
  • Loading branch information
Lucas Willering committed May 14, 2020
1 parent 7ee61eb commit 45b72cc
Show file tree
Hide file tree
Showing 14 changed files with 3,691 additions and 549 deletions.
1,829 changes: 1,389 additions & 440 deletions package-lock.json

Large diffs are not rendered by default.

21 changes: 11 additions & 10 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-23,29 +23,25 @@
{
"corejs": "3.1.3",
"useBuiltIns": "usage",
"debug": false
"debug": true
}
]
]
},
"postcss": {
"plugins": {
"autoprefixer": {}
}
},
"keywords": [],
"author": "",
"license": "Apache-2.0",
"dependencies": {
"@babel/polyfill": "^7.8.7",
"dotenv": "^8.2.0",
"ejs": "^2.7.4",
"express": "^4.17.1",
"vue": "^2.6.11"
},
"devDependencies": {
"@artificialsolutions/tie-api-client": "^1.3.5",
"@babel/core": "^7.9.0",
"@babel/core": "^7.9.6",
"@babel/node": "^7.8.7",
"@babel/polyfill": "^7.8.7",
"@babel/preset-env": "^7.9.0",
"@babel/register": "^7.9.0",
"@vue/test-utils": "^1.0.0-beta.32",
Expand All @@ -62,16 +58,21 @@
"jsdom-global": "^3.0.2",
"mocha": "^7.1.1",
"nock": "^10.0.6",
"node-sass": "^4.13.1",
"node-sass": "^4.14.1",
"postcss-cli": "^7.1.0",
"postcss-custom-properties": "^9.1.1",
"postcss-loader": "^3.0.0",
"postcss-nested": "^4.2.1",
"precss": "^4.0.0",
"prettier": "^1.19.1",
"style-loader": "^1.2.1",
"vue-loader": "^15.9.1",
"vue-style-loader": "^4.1.2",
"vue-template-compiler": "^2.6.11",
"webpack": "^4.42.1",
"webpack-bundle-analyzer": "^3.6.1",
"webpack-cli": "^3.3.11",
"webpack-dev-server": "^3.10.3",
"webpack-dev-server": "^3.11.0",
"webpack-merge": "^4.2.2"
},
"heroku-run-build-script": true
Expand Down
6 changes: 6 additions & 0 deletions postcss.config.js
Original file line number Diff line number Diff line change
@@ -0,0 +1,6 @@
module.exports = {
plugins: [
require('precss'),
require('autoprefixer')
]
}
8 changes: 4 additions & 4 deletions src/components/Header.vue
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,7 @@ export default {

<style scoped>
.header {
background: var(--header-bg-color);
background: var(--header-bg-color, #4e8cff);
min-height: 64px;
border-top-left-radius: 9px;
border-top-right-radius: 9px;
Expand All @@ -53,11 +53,11 @@ export default {
height: 24px;
width: 24px;
margin: 0 8px 0 8px;
color: var(--header-fg-color);
color: var(--header-fg-color, #ffffff);
}
.header__title {
color: var(--header-fg-color);
color: var(--header-fg-color, #ffffff);
}
.header__close-button {
Expand All @@ -72,7 +72,7 @@ export default {
.header__close-icon {
height: 32px;
width: 32px;
color: var(--header-fg-color);
color: var(--header-fg-color, #ffffff);
}
.header__close-icon {
Expand Down
6 changes: 3 additions & 3 deletions src/components/LaunchButton.vue
Original file line number Diff line number Diff line change
Expand Up @@ -35,7 +35,7 @@ export default {
</script>
<style scoped>
.launch-button {
background-color: var(--header-bg-color);
background-color: var(--header-bg-color, #4e8cff);
width: 60px;
height: 60px;
background-position: center;
Expand All @@ -55,14 +55,14 @@ export default {
.launch-button__open-icon {
height: 26px;
width: 26px;
color: var(--light-fg-color);
color: var(--light-fg-color, #ffffff);
}
.launch-button__close-icon {
stroke-width: 1;
height: 32px;
width: 32px;
color: var(--light-fg-color);
color: var(--light-fg-color, #ffffff);
}
.launch-button:hover {
Expand Down
2 changes: 1 addition & 1 deletion src/components/UserInput.vue
Original file line number Diff line number Diff line change
Expand Up @@ -86,7 +86,7 @@ export default {
bottom: 0;
display: flex;
justify-content: space-between;
background-color: var(--user-input-bg-color);
background-color: var(--user-input-bg-color, #f4f7f9);
border-bottom-left-radius: 10px;
border-bottom-right-radius: 10px;
transition: background-color 0.2s ease, box-shadow 0.2s ease;
Expand Down
62 changes: 31 additions & 31 deletions src/components/messages/ButtonsMessage.vue
Original file line number Diff line number Diff line change
Expand Up @@ -86,9 +86,9 @@ export default {
<style>
.btn {
border: 1px solid var(--button-bg-color);
background: var(--button-bg-color);
color: var(--button-fg-color);
border: 1px solid var(--button-bg-color, #4e8cff);
background: var(--button-bg-color, #4e8cff);
color: var(--button-fg-color, #ffffff);
cursor: pointer;
font-weight: 400;
text-align: center;
Expand All @@ -110,28 +110,28 @@ export default {
.btn.selected,
.btn:not(.expired) .btn:hover {
color: var(--button-bg-color);
background: var(--button-fg-color);
color: var(--button-bg-color, #4e8cff);
background: var(--button-fg-color, #ffffff);
}
.buttons.selected,
.buttons:not(.expired) .btn:hover {
color: var(--button-bg-color);
background: var(--button-fg-color);
color: var(--button-bg-color, #4e8cff);
background: var(--button-fg-color, #ffffff);
}
.buttons.expired .btn {
cursor: default;
color: var(--expired-color);
background: var(--button-fg-color);
border: 1px solid var(--expired-color);
color: var(--expired-color, #a9a9a9);
background: var(--button-fg-color, #ffffff);
border: 1px solid var(--expired-color, #a9a9a9);
}
.buttons.expired .btn.selected {
cursor: default;
color: var(--button-fg-color);
background: var(--expired-color);
border: 1px solid var(--expired-color);
color: var(--button-fg-color, #ffffff);
background: var(--expired-color, #a9a9a9);
border: 1px solid var(--expired-color, #a9a9a9);
}
.buttons h5 {
Expand All @@ -142,11 +142,11 @@ export default {
margin-bottom: 0.6rem;
font-size: 1rem;
font-weight: 500;
color: var(--buttons-title-color);
color: var(--buttons-title-color, #263238);
}
.buttons.expired h5 {
color: var(--expired-color);
color: var(--expired-color, #a9a9a9);
}
/* a.btn:first-child {
Expand All @@ -158,49 +158,49 @@ a.btn:last-child {
} */
.btn.secondary {
background: var(--secondary-color);
border-color: var(--secondary-color);
background: var(--secondary-color, #6c757d);
border-color: var(--secondary-color, #6c757d);
}
.buttons:not(.expired) .btn.secondary:hover {
color: var(--secondary-color) !important;
color: var(--secondary-color, #6c757d) !important;
}
.btn.success {
background: var(--success-color);
border-color: var(--success-color);
background: var(--success-color, #28a745);
border-color: var(--success-color, #28a745);
}
.buttons:not(.expired) .btn.success:hover {
color: var(--success-color) !important;
color: var(--success-color, #28a745) !important;
}
.btn.warning {
background: var(--warning-color);
border-color: var(--warning-color);
color: var(--dark-fg-color);
background: var(--warning-color, #ffc107);
border-color: var(--warning-color, #ffc107);
color: var(--dark-fg-color, #263238);
}
.buttons:not(.expired) .btn.warning:hover {
color: var(--warning-color) !important;
color: var(--warning-color, #ffc107) !important;
}
.btn.danger {
background: var(--danger-color);
border-color: var(--danger-color);
background: var(--danger-color, #dc3545);
border-color: var(--danger-color, #dc3545);
}
.buttons:not(.expired) .btn.danger:hover {
color: var(--danger-color) !important;
color: var(--danger-color, #dc3545) !important;
}
.btn.info {
background: var(--info-color);
border-color: var(--info-color);
background: var(--info-color, #17a2b8);
border-color: var(--info-color, #17a2b8);
}
.buttons:not(.expired) .btn.info:hover {
color: var(--info-color) !important;
color: var(--info-color, #17a2b8) !important;
}
</style>
16 changes: 8 additions & 8 deletions src/components/messages/CardMessage.vue
Original file line number Diff line number Diff line change
Expand Up @@ -140,9 +140,9 @@ export default {
-ms-flex-direction: column;
flex-direction: column;
word-wrap: break-word;
background-color: var(--card-bg-color);
background-color: var(--card-bg-color, #ffffff);
background-clip: border-box;
border: 1px solid var(--light-border-color);
border: 1px solid var(--light-border-color, #c9c9c9);
border-radius: 0.25rem;
border-bottom-left-radius: 0px;
}
Expand Down Expand Up @@ -173,7 +173,7 @@ export default {
.card-body h5 {
font-size: 1.25rem;
font-weight: 500;
color: var(--bot-message-fg-color);
color: var(--bot-message-fg-color, #263238);
}
.card-body h6 {
Expand All @@ -188,7 +188,7 @@ export default {
line-height: 1.6;
white-space: pre-wrap;
-webkit-font-smoothing: subpixel-antialiased;
color: var(--bot-message-fg-color);
color: var(--bot-message-fg-color, #263238);
margin-top: 0.6rem;
margin-bottom: 0.6rem;
}
Expand All @@ -199,7 +199,7 @@ export default {
}
.card .clickablelist-message__item:first-child {
border-top: 1px solid var(--light-border-color);
border-top: 1px solid var(--light-border-color, #c9c9c9);
border-top-left-radius: initial;
border-top-right-radius: initial;
}
Expand All @@ -212,17 +212,17 @@ export default {
.card .buttons {
text-align: center;
border-top: 1px solid var( --light-border-color);
border-top: 1px solid var( --light-border-color, #c9c9c9);
padding: 12px;
}
.card .links {
border-top: 1px solid var( --light-border-color);
border-top: 1px solid var( --light-border-color, #c9c9c9);
padding: 12px;
}
.card .links a {
color: var(--card-link-color);
color: var(--card-link-color, #007bff);
font-size: 0.9rem;
padding-right: 10px;
text-decoration: none;
Expand Down
Loading

0 comments on commit 45b72cc

Please sign in to comment.